HoHoHo said:
ChrisW. said:
Or to release cash ... I tend to agree.

Porsche would not allow OPC's to make 40% or 30% or probably even 20% on base spec cars ... maybe they make this on the accessories ??
I honestly don’t know what margin the dealers work to per car, but I’m guessing it’s low.

Servicing, bonuses and used car sales probably make up 90% of their GP I would suggest.

OPC’s probably have targets for % of cars they need to sell that are EV’s by the end of the year as Porsche GB does.

We all know there were hundreds of new Taycan’s listed online a few months ago that disappeared overnight. We also know that Porsche sales are still about 20% behind last year…with Taycan sales globally about 50% down.

So there are probably still a lot of Taycan’s in a field somewhere that need to find a home.
